FSFG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2017 in Review

26 of the 4,410 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in First Savings Financial Group (FSFG) for Q4 2017, worth a combined $23.5M — up 9.3% from $21.5M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 2 funds opened new FSFG positions and 1 closed out — a net gain of 1 holder — while 6 added to existing stakes and 6 trimmed.

The largest buyer was AllianceBernstein, adding an estimated $306K. The largest seller was Wellington Management Group, cutting an estimated $163K.
